#b31625 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b31625 is composed of 70.2% red, 8.6%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 79.3%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 354.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#b31625 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c4a with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#b31625 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b31625 has RGB values of R:179, G:22,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.79,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11736613.

Shades and Tints of #b31625
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b31625
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666364 is the less saturated color, while #c20718 is the most saturated one.
